When a child has a conductive hearing impairment, there may be an abnormality in the structure of the outer ear canal or middle ear. Or, there may be a large amount of cerumen (wax) lodged in the ear canal. Another possible cause is fluid in the middle ear that interferes with the transfer of sound. hangarbot.com https://orlandovillausa.com

WebSensorineural hearing loss (SNHL) happens when there is damage to tiny hair cells in the cochlear and/or the auditory nerve. In children, the most common causes of SNHL include inner ear abnormalities, genetic variations, jaundice (or a yellowing of the skin or whites of the eyes), and viral infection from the mother during pregnancy. An ear infection (sometimes called acute otitis media) is an infection of the middle ear, the air-filled space behind the eardrum that contains the tiny vibrating bones of the ear. A conductive hearing impairment results from a blockage or damage to the outer or middle ear structures. This problem interferes with the transmission of sound through the outer and middle ear to the inner ear, resulting in reduced loudness of the sound (quantity of sound).
